Why Boat Insurance Matters Here

Potomac River mixes heavy recreational traffic, federal waters, bridges, and tidal currents. A modern boat policy bundles hull (your boat), liability (bodily injury & property damage you cause), medical payments, and options like on-water towing, fuel-spill liability, salvage & wreck removal, and fishing gear/personal effects. If you trailer from Andrews AFB, we’ll address trailer coverage and auto liability during road transport.

Planning Chesapeake Bay runs or Anacostia navigation? We’ll set navigation limits matching your plans and discuss seasonal lay-up, storm surge protection, and marina requirements.

Washington D.C. Boating Basics (What to Know)

Registration & Title

Motorized vessels over 16ft or>10hp must register with DC Dept. of Motor Vehicles. Keep registration aboard when underway.

Boating Safety Certificate

PWC operators and certain powerboat operators need DC Boating Safety Certificate via approved courses. Carry while operating.

Local Planning

Check Potomac tides (NOAA stations), no-wake zones near monuments/bridges, and pumpout locations. Marinas require insurance proof.

Boat Insurance FAQ - Andrews AFB, Washington D.C.

Is boat insurance required in Washington D.C.?

Washington D.C. does not legally require boat insurance, but marinas on Potomac/Anacostia demand liability proof before docking. Lenders require hull coverage for financed boats. Auto policies cover trailer liability on roads but not water-separate boat policy needed upon launch. With heavy Potomac traffic and federal waters, liability coverage is essential.

What's the difference between Agreed Value and Actual Cash Value for hull coverage?

Agreed Value pays full insured amount on total loss without depreciation-the agreed worth at inception. ACV pays depreciated market value at loss time, often less than replacement cost. Agreed Value costs more but avoids disputes, ideal for upgraded/custom boats or financed vessels.

Do I need a Boating Safety Certificate to get insurance in D.C.?

DC requires Boating Safety Certificate for PWC and certain powerboat operators via approved courses. It's legally required on water, and carriers may offer premium discounts for completion. Carry it while operating; it aids insurability.

What navigation territory for Potomac to Chesapeake Bay?

Navigation limits define coverage area-wrong limits void protection. Inland-only policy won't cover Chesapeake transit from Potomac/Anacostia. We set territories for your plans: Potomac River, Anacostia, Washington Channel, Chesapeake Bay radius for fishing/offshore. Confirm before heading out.

Does boat insurance cover on-water towing and salvage?

Not standard-add on-water towing (ungrounding, fuel, tows to marina) and separate salvage/wreck removal (high costs for waterway recovery). Essential for Potomac distances and Chesapeake exposure.

What is fuel spill liability and do I need it?

Covers cleanup/third-party costs from fuel/oil discharge (excluded from standard liability). Federal/state laws hold owners responsible; low-cost add-on vital for tidal Potomac areas.

Does my homeowners or auto policy cover my boat?

Limited-homeowners may cover small/low-value boats excluding liability; auto covers trailer on-road only. Standalone boat policy needed for hull, water liability, med pay, towing, salvage.

How does lay-up season affect my boat insurance premium and coverage?

Lay-up declares non-use period (winter storage) for premium credit, but voids coverage if used. Match dates to haul-out; some offer storm haul-out reimbursement.
